Like Eagle, HYDRAA, Body For Food Safety: CM

Osmania biscuits are not just a biscuit. They are the heart of Hyderabad’s chai culture. One cannot think of Hyderabadi chai without the sweet and salty Osmania biscuit.

Recent raids across Hyderabad have shown how the biscuits are made in unhygienic conditions with chemicals and rotten eggs. Media was full of visuals for a couple of days. Today, the situation is such that one thinks twice before biting into an Osmania biscuit. Given that many are health conscious and given the threat of colon cancer even in young people, the videos really scared the daylights out of Hyderabadi citizens.

ADVERTISEMENT

Then there were raids on rotten chicken. Ever since Revanth Reddy government came to power, food raids have become common and the citizens are now scared to eat in small eateries and bakeries.

Citizens are concerned of the widespread network of operators who use such sub-standard products and hazardous chemicals.

Gauging the mood of citizens, CM Revanth Reddy has announced that a separate body will be formed in the state for food safety. Like Eagle for drugs and HYDRAA for encroachments, the government will soon come up with a body to carry out food contamination and adulteration. Incidentally, there is FSSAI to monitor safety standards. But many small-time and even big outlets get away by putting fake FSSAI stickers.

The netizens are happy with CM’s decision as a true Hyderabadi can never compromise on his chai time by not having an Osmania biscuit.
